As it appears on Asher Roth and Nottz's Rawth EP, "Enforce the Law" is the shortest track by about a minute. It's a quick, gritty cut that, based on its length, didn't seem terribly likely to become the duo's next single. But that's exactly what it's become. Asher and Nottz have stretched "Enforce the Law" out to become the soundtrack to a nearly seven-minute short film that features them paying homage to Training Day. The acting is rough, as expected, but it works, I guess. I still prefer Dave Chappelle and Wayne Brady's interpretation of the same scene.
